Sanitation Practices, Protocols and Policies at Dino Dilio Beauty Studio

In the aesthetics industry, three corporations set the standard for best practices. They are: Milady, Sanitation Conversation and the Barbicide Sanitation and Disease Control Program. I am certified by all three. As well, I have always followed the principles and practices set by the Ontario Ministry of Health. These professional procedures protect both of us, and in context of Covid-19, I've expanded them specifically for studio appointments.

  1. My studio is a private, safe, well ventilated and air-conditioned environment.

  2. I see only one client at a time. Clients are booked 30 minutes apart, one from the other, to ensure complete sanitation.

  3. Hand sanitizer is available in the lobby of the building by the elevators, in my studio and in the rest room.

  4. On rainy days and in winter months, you are welcome to bring slippers or comfortable shoes to change into. Unfortunately, bare-footedness is on the naughty list.

  5. My hands are washed and sanitized before service begins.

  6. I will happily wear a mask (and gloves upon request).

  7. I change into a freshly laundered shirt or smock for each client.

  8. A fresh new set of sanitized brushes are used for each service.

  9. We do not double dip into makeup products, unless they are your own.

  10. I use disposable mascara wands unless the mascara is yours.

  11. You’re welcome to bring your own brushes, but they must be clean and sanitized for your appointment.

  12. Here are some guidelines on Cleaning Your Makeup Brushes before our session.

  13. If you have long hair, please bring along your own hair-band, elastic or clips.

  14. Sterile water is used to moisten skin and activate certain kinds of makeup.

  15. Makeup testers are sanitized after each appointment.

  16. All equipment and surfaces are professionally sanitized between clients, so as to return the studio and bathroom to sterile environments. Trash is emptied after each session.

  17. Material Safety Data Sheets (MSDS) Literature about sanitation and disinfecting products are available upon request.

  18. All bookings are secured with a credit card or e-transfer to be received 24 hours before your appointment.

  19. Guests are not permitted. This keeps the focus entirely on you!

  20. Please sanitize your cell phone.

YOUR DIY Compact Sanitation Kit

These are the essential items that you can easily carry with you to keep you safe in places that may not appear completely sanitary. Pack your kit in a Zip-loc bag.

  • Disinfectant wipes (alcohol, Lysol, Clorox) to clean chair seats, chair arms and tables. (Put a few sheets in their own Zip-loc bag.)

  • Disposable gloves to use for disinfecting

  • Folded paper towel to dry surfaces after disinfecting

  • Hand sanitizer and hand lotion

  • Tissues
